Seega täiendavad kõik kolm artiklit üksteist ja aitavad VKE-de rahvusvahelistumise kompleksset protsessi paremini mõistaThe objective of the thesis is to provide a deeper understanding of the export behavior of small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) in the context of emerging economies on the example of Russia and China. This thesis is based on three empirical studies that address different aspects of export behavior. Study 1 is a pilot study providing initial evidence on the potential factors that can affect the early and rapid internationalization of SMEs (born globals) from emerging economies. Using China as a research context, it presents some important characteristics of exporters (born globals and non-born globals) and opens the topic by highlighting significant differences between them, using simple statistical analysis. The Study indicates two avenues for further research: to focus on deeper analysis of the key factors that can drive the early and rapid internationalization of SMEs from emerging economies (Study 2) and to highlight the role of the institutional environment for SMEs’ export behavior (Study 3). Study 2 provides insights into the impacts of three factors – foreign knowledge, networks and government support – as identified in Study 1 on the emergence of Chinese born globals by applying logistic analysis. The last two factors are also analyzed as moderators between foreign knowledge and the likelihood of early and rapid internationalization. The symbiosis of these factors is explained and some important reasons for heterogeneity among exporters are outlined. Study 3 reveals the role of home country institutions on SMEs’ export behavior. The context of Russia offers interesting insights into this area as its institutional environment is often characterized as unfavorable and exporting is rather challenging for SMEs. Evidence is provided regarding the institutional factors that can impede or facilitate SMEs’ internationalization. Thus, all Studies are complementary and provide a better understanding of the complex process of SMEs’ internationalization.https://www.ester.ee/record=b5261186~S

    Virtually all Arabists at some point ask themselves whether they should take into account specialized literature in Arabic, whether to take part in conferences held in Arabic countries, and which language they should choose for publishing their work. In this paper, we try to review this question in a broader context of the language of scholarship. By adducing historical and typological parallels, we reflect on the role of language in conducting research and exchanging ideas. The authors of this article are both linguists specialized in Semitic languages; therefore, they concentrate on the problems of their field, although these should be relevant to some extent also for the adjacent fields in the humanities

    This document is a catalogue of WEB services providing data on global trade. It updates to March 2010 the first edition published in 2007. Each service is described in the catalogue according to a form specifying data fields, geographical coverage, temporal span, search criteria and reporting facilities on data records. The information has been derived from WEB sites, email contacts with service providers, trial runs, and interviews with users. Services listed herein offer data on imports and exports on all types of commodities over the last decade. The use of the data is generic: they can support studies related to trade in diverse domains and applications. Trade data described in this catalogue have a regulatory origin because they stem from declarations made by importers and exporters to customs authorities. The data are collected at national level, processed, and released for public access under formats respecting national provisions on data confidentiality. Trade data are released in transactional or statistical format and may have a national or multi-national scope. Services on trade transactions are run by companies and are accessible after the payment of subscription fees. Services on statistical data (obtained by aggregating transactions) often have a multi-national scope and are provided for free access by international and governmental organizations, and statistical offices, or as pay services by companies.     The article is devoted to the problems of formation and positioning of the category of factual communities in legal science. The relevance of this phenomenon in law is due to the need for a broader approach to the study of a set of factual circumstances that are the grounds for the emergence, change or termination of legal relations, which undoubtedly contributes to a more effective implementation of the goals of both lawmaking and law enforcement practice. The purpose of this article is to determine the prerequisites for the formation of the legal category under consideration, to identify the main types of factual communities, as well as to understand their functions. Achievement of this goal will make it possible with sufficient certainty to identify the main characteristics of the specified legal category, as well as to determine functional links with related legal concepts. The methodological basis of the article was made by modern achievements in the theory of knowledge. In the process of research, theoretical, general philosophical (dialectical, analysis, synthesis, deduction, systemic method), as well as traditional legal methods (formal-logical, normative-dogmatic and others) were used. In the course of the research, based on the analysis of the relationship of physical objects, phenomena and their groups among themselves, it was concluded that the term factual communities is a logical continuation of the development of the theory of legal facts, reflects the interconnected association of individual legal facts, as well as their actual composition. Such associations can have a different scope, as a result of which their functionality may also differ. The primary factual commonality is the actual composition. Factual systems are larger in volume and more complex in structure

    How Does Privatization Work? Evidence from the Russian Shops

    Get PDF
    We use a survey of 452 Russian shops, most of which were privatized between 1992 and 1993, to measure the importance of alternative channels through which privatization promotes restructuring. Restructuring is measured as capital renovation, change in suppliers, increase in hours that stores stay open, and layoffs. There is strong evidence that the presence of new owners and new managers raises the likelihood of restructuring. In contrast, there is no evidence that equity incentives of old managers promote restructuring. The evidence points to the critical role that new human capital plays in economic transformation.

    The article deals with the problem of professional training of future teachers of preschool education institutions to implement the development of child abilities in the modern information society. Attention is paid to the impact of childhood education on achieving significant success in various fields of Science and Art in the future. The analysis of the works of scientists allowed us to generalize the interpretation of the categories: "makings", "abilities", "giftedness". The foundation of a creative personality is its creativity, the determinant of which is the activity of the individual as a search and transformative activity that is not stimulated from the outside. The introduction of information and communication technologies affects the education system, causing significant changes in the content and methods of teaching. The tasks that should be based on the use of information and communication technologies in preschool education are presented. The functions should be performed by modern information and communication technologies in the educational and information environment of preschool educational institutions
